We are delighted to announce the signing of Ali Stewart from Swindon Town!
The central midfielder joins the Yellows from The Robins’ academy where he previously worked under Parkway assistant manager Lee Peacock.
Speaking on his arrival, the 18-year-old said: “I’m really looking forward to my time at Plymouth Parkway and hope I can make a strong impact and help the team.
“Lee Peacock was a big factor in the process, having known him from his time with Swindon Town. I can’t wait to get started!”
Our new arrival, who started in a third round FA Youth Cup tie against QPR back in December, looks to be an exciting addition to the Parkway squad according to Lee Peacock.
The assistant manager said: “Ali came into Swindon quite late but made an impact and was offered a scholarship by the club.”
“However, he is a really intelligent lad and wanted to continue his education so signed an extended schoolboy contract which allowed him to play for the youth team whilst doing his A levels.
“Even though his training was limited he still became a starter due to his in-game reliability in several positions and his outstanding work rate.
“He signed for Swindon as a hard-working striker but converted into a box-to-box goal-scoring midfielder. He can play any role across midfield, as a striker, and has even covered at CB.
“He is a great lad and will fit in well with the boys here. His hard-working attitude and ability will give him a great foundation for a successful transition into men’s football with us.”
The midfielder has even been likened to our own midfield maestro Callum Hall.
“I’ve not seen him play in over a year but if he has continued on the same path then I’d say he’s similar to Callum (Hall)”, said Peacock.
“He’s a box-to-box attacker, he scores goals, assists, and defends really well in own half. Hewas the hardest working players in academy when he was with me.”
